refactor(autologin): return early if fetch metadata is set

This commit is contained in:
Trong Huu Nguyen
2023-09-25 15:07:11 +02:00
parent 0ce938c101
commit 7a72586ca8

View File

@@ -164,8 +164,8 @@ func isNavigationRequest(r *http.Request) bool {
// check for top-level navigation requests
mode := r.Header.Get("Sec-Fetch-Mode")
dest := r.Header.Get("Sec-Fetch-Dest")
if mode == "navigate" && dest == "document" {
return true
if mode != "" && dest != "" {
return mode == "navigate" && dest == "document"
}
// fallback if browser doesn't support fetch metadata